iPhone SE (2nd & 3rd Generation)

The iPhone SE offers tremendous value for users who want strong performance without spending on a flagship. The 2nd generation SE, released in 2020, uses the A13 chip — the same as in the iPhone 11 — giving it snappy speed. The 3rd generation SE (2022) upgraded to the A15 chip, aligning it with newer iPhones in performance.

  • Size & Design: Compact 4.7-inch screen, classic design with Touch ID.

  • Camera: Single 12 MP rear camera, but very capable thanks to computational photography.

  • Battery: Not as large as Pro models, but optimized because of an efficient chip.

  • Target user: Great for budget-conscious buyers or those who prefer small phones with a physical Home button.


iPhone 11 Series

The iPhone 11 lineup was a major hit, offering a good mix of power, affordability, and camera quality.

  • iPhone 11: Dual 12 MP cameras (wide + ultra-wide), A13 chip, LCD screen.

  • iPhone 11 Pro / Pro Max: Triple-lens setup (wide, ultra-wide, telephoto), better OLED display, more premium finish, and longer battery life.

Strengths:

  • Excellent battery life (especially the Pro Max)

  • Great photo performance in varied lighting

  • Still supported by iOS updates for years


iPhone 12 Series

The iPhone 12 series ushered in a big design shift and 5G support.

  • Models: iPhone 12, 12 mini, 12 Pro, 12 Pro Max.

  • Chips: A14 Bionic for all models — powerful and efficient.

  • Design: Flat edges, reminiscent of older iPhones, but modernized.

  • Display: OLED across the series.

  • 5G: Full 5G support, making it future-proof for connectivity.

  • Camera: Pro models have LiDAR, better zoom range; mini and base have dual cameras.

Good for: Users who want modern design + 5G without paying top-tier Pro Max prices.


iPhone 13 Series

Building on the 12, the iPhone 13 family brought meaningful upgrades.

  • Chip: A15 Bionic — faster and more power-efficient.

  • Camera: Improved low-light performance, Cinematic Video (on Pro), sensor-shift stabilization.

  • Display: Pro models have ProMotion (120 Hz) for smoother animations.

  • Battery Life: Larger batteries + efficiency lead to noticeably better endurance.

  • Design: Slightly smaller notch, new color options.

The 13 mini remains a rare compact flagship, ideal for users who don’t want a large phone.


iPhone 14 Series

With the iPhone 14, Apple kept improving in meaningful ways.

  • Models: iPhone 14, 14 Plus, 14 Pro, 14 Pro Max.

  • New Features: Crash Detection, Emergency SOS via satellite (on some models), always-on display for Pro.

  • Chip: Pro models use A16; non-Pro often still use A15 (depending on market).

  • Camera: Pro models have a 48 MP main sensor; great for high-resolution photos.

  • Design: Similar size options, but more internal refinement.

Great pick if you want advanced safety features + top-tier photography.

iPhone Pro vs Non-Pro Models

One of the most important comparisons: Pro vs non-Pro.

  • Materials: Pro often uses stainless steel vs aluminum on base models.

  • Display: Pro models usually offer ProMotion (120 Hz) and better brightness.

  • Camera: Pro gets more lenses, better zoom, LiDAR.

  • Performance: Sometimes more RAM on Pro; better thermal management.

  • Price: Pro models are more expensive, but offer features that power users will appreciate.

Choosing Pro or not depends largely on how much you care about photography, screen quality, and build.


Performance Comparison — Chipsets

Over the years, Apple’s A-series chips have powered major performance leaps:

  • A13 (iPhone 11 / SE): Very capable even today.

  • A14 (iPhone 12): First 5 nm chip — great efficiency.

  • A15 (iPhone 13 / SE 3): Improved GPU, better battery.

  • A16 (iPhone 14 Pro): Higher efficiency, more performance gains.

  • Future (A17+): Expected to push even further.

In real-world use, newer chips mean smoother multitasking, faster app launches, and better graphics for games.


Camera Capabilities Across Models

When iPhone models are compared by camera, differences become clear:

  • Dual vs Triple Lens: Some older or base models have two lenses (wide + ultra-wide), while Pro models add a telephoto.

  • Sensor Size: Newer Pros often have larger sensors (e.g. 48 MP on iPhone 14 Pro) for better detail.

  • Computational Photography: Features like Deep Fusion, Night Mode, Photographic Styles improve shots even on simpler hardware.

  • Video: Cinematic mode (13+) enables depth-based video; ProRes (in Pro) allows higher-quality video capture.

If photography or videography is your priority, leaning toward Pro models makes sense.
